Sauté Aromatics:
In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at.
Add the chopped onion and sauté for 3-4 minutes until softened.
Add the gar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
Cook the Peas:
Add the peas to the pot and stir to combine with the onions and garlic.
Pour in the vegetable broth and bring the mixture to a simmer.
Let it cook for about 10 minutes, until the peas are tender and the flavors have melded together.
Blend the Soup:
Use an immersion blender to blend the soup directly in the pot until smooth.
Alternatively, you can transfer the soup in batches to a regular blender to purée it.
For a chunkier texture, blend only half of the soup and leave some peas whole.
Add Creaminess (Optional):
Stir in the coconut milk or heavy cream if you want a creamier consistency.
Add salt, pepper, and chopped fresh mint to taste.
Finish and Serve:
For an extra burst of flavor, sprinkle some lemon zest over the soup before serving.
Ladle the soup into bowls and garnish with additional mint or a drizzle of cream if desired. Serve hot.
